BIOL 3414 - Comparati ve Physiology

The integration of neural, hormonal, nutritional, circulatory, and excretory functions of the animal as related to cell-origin interrelationships. Laboratory exercises include instrumentation and techniques required for the study of animal systems. Three hours lecture/ discussion and three hours of laboratory each week. Prerequisites: BIOL 1214 and either BIOL 2414 or BIOL 2003, 2041, 2103, and 2141, or permission of instructor. (TBA)
